The HIS HD 7970 X2 IceQ X² graphics card from AMD is built on the GCN 1.0 architecture and was officially introduced on 31.08.2012. The graphics processor is manufactured using a modern process. The 352 mm² die contains approximately 4.3 billion transistorsistors transistors. The model's computational arsenal includes 2048 universal processors. Also available are 0 specialized cores for ray rendering and 0 cores for accelerating artificial intelligence. The memory subsystem features GDDR5 modules with a total capacity of 3 GB. The bus width is 384 bit bits, and the peak data exchange rate is 264.00 GB/s. In standard mode, the core operates at 925 MHz, but auto-overclocking technology allows it to reach 0 MHz under load. The TDP level for this model is 500 W, so for a build, it\'s advisable to choose quality cooling and a power supply unit of at least 900 W.
